If you want it to fit even half way decent make sure you take it to someone who has experience with fiberglass. I've done countless body kits, some cheap, some mid range, and some expensive kit and all of them are hit or miss on quality and fitment.
I've had super expensive kits that still had air bubbles and pinholes throughout. Some have had the layers of fiberglass separating, bodylines completely off, corners broken, cracked, chipped, etc.
I am more than capable of making your body kit fit like factory but don't expect it to be maaco cheap.
